About Cyberbully (2011) — A mother's desperate battle against online bullies
Cyberbully (2011) is a gripping drama that delves into the dark world of online harassment. Directed by Charles Binamé, this TV movie tells the story of a mother's desperate attempt to shield her teenage daughter from the cruel taunts of cyberbullies. As the situation spirals out of control, the mother must confront the harsh realities of the digital age and find a way to protect her child from the hurtful words that can have devastating consequences. With a talented young cast, including Emily Osment and Kay Panabaker, Cyberbully (2011) is a thought-provoking exploration of the impact of technology on our lives and relationships.
